Posted on 3/6/26 at 9:42 am to ragincajun03
Problem with the SPR is it can’t be distributed easily. I think the max they can distribute is 2 mbpd. And that’s probably assuming we’ve had a decline in other areas. There is just not enough infrastructure to make up for the 20 mbpd that goes through the straight.
